Linguoverted mandibular canine teeth (LMC) is a common malocclusion in dogs. Several inclined bite-plane techniques using acrylic resin have been introduced to correct LMC in dogs. Although these techniques have suggested modifications to overcome shortcomings, there are still limitations; e.g., high technical sensitivity, as the viscous acrylic resin must still be fabricated in the oral cavity. The authors developed a novel method for small-breed dogs that uses a doughy acrylic resin form to achieve an easy intraoral design and extraoral fabrication. Eight small-breed dogs were presented to evaluate and treat malocclusion causing palatal trauma. First, a Class-1 malocclusion with linguoversion of the mandibular canine teeth (6 dogs with unilateral LMC and 2 dogs with bilateral) was diagnosed based on oral examination. Dogs were treated with the new method using a doughy acrylic resin form for 6 to 7 wk and had posttreatment follow-up 1 y after the procedure. All treated canine teeth were in correct positions 1 y after the appliances were removed. Key clinical message: The authors believe that the new method using a doughy acrylic resin form could be a good alternative for veterinarians to use when treating LMC.

Introduction: Tooth fracture is one of the most common traumatic maxillofacial injuries in dogs and cats. For fractures with pulp exposure occurring in functionally important teeth, the literature indicates that root canal treatment (RCT) is an effective therapy option that may be the remedy of choice before extraction. The most commonly reported fractures in the United States involve canine teeth; however, fractures of the maxillary fourth premolars are more common in Korea, where there are many small-and medium-sized dogs. RCT mechanically and chemically removes pulp tissue and bacteria (cleaning and shaping) from the infected root canal, and obturates the root canal with filling material to restore tooth functionality without inflammation. Various techniques, instruments, and materials used in humans have been modified for application in veterinary dentistry. Methods: This study analyzed the results of RCT of the maxillary fourth premolar in 120 small-and medium-sized dogs (weighing less than 25 kg) using three different sealers (silicone-based sealer, bioceramic sealer, and calcium hydroxide-based sealer) through a simple application of the single-cone technique. Results: The overall success rate of RCT in maxillary fourth premolars was 90.83%, with 8.33% no evidence of failure (NEF) and 0.83% failure. Discussion: There were no significant differences between the three different sealers. Furthermore, preexisting periapical lesion (PAL) was reconfirmed as a factor in reducing the success rate of RCT. In addition, the working length and master apical file of each root were analyzed in our study as a novel reference for endodontic veterinarians.

This study aimed to evaluate the spontaneous recovery of bone deformity after surgical excision of craniofacial dermoid cysts in pediatrics. Pediatric patients who underwent excision of a dermoid cyst were included in the study. A prospective analysis was conducted to evaluate the amount of bone recovery by comparing the depth of bony concavity in the preoperative and postoperative (6 months) ultrasonography. In 145 of 187 patients with preoperative imaging available, the mean size of dermoid cysts was 1.4 cm3 (range, 0.1 to 9.5), and 41.4% (60/145 cases) showed cranial bone depression. In the comparison of preoperative and postoperative ultrasonography of 30 patients, the mean depth of bony cavity decreased significantly from 4.0 to 0.9 mm (p<0.001) after a mean of 6.7 months postoperatively. There was 13.3% (4/30) of mild (≤2.0 mm), 40.0% (12/30) of moderate (>2.0 to ≤4.0 mm), and 46.7% (14/30) of severe (>4.0 mm) depression, and the concavity depth significantly decreased in all groups (p = 0.028, mild; p<0.001, moderate; p<0.001 severe). Within the limitations of the study it seems that significant recovery of cranial bone depression does take place within 6 months after excision of craniofacial dermoid cysts in pediatric patients, saving the need for immediate reconstruction.

Periodontal disease is one of the most common disorders in the oral cavity of dogs and humans. Periodontitis, the irreversible periodontal disease, arises progressively from gingivitis, the reversible inflammatory condition caused by dental plaque. Although the etiology of periodontitis has been widely studied in humans, it is still insufficient for the etiological studies on periodontitis in dogs. Many studies have reported that human periodontitis-related bacteria are putative pathogens responsible for periodontitis in dogs. However, most of these studies have focused on the appearance of a specific microbiome, and most of the cohort studies have insufficient sample sizes to generalize their results. In the present study, subgingival samples collected from 336 teeth were categorized into three groups at first, based on clinical outcomes (healthy, gingivitis, periodontitis). Subsequently, the periodontitis samples were further divided into three subgroups (early, moderate, and advanced periodontitis) according to the degree of periodontal attachment loss. Healthy and gingivitis were grouped as a reversible group, and the three subgroups were grouped as an irreversible group. To investigate trends of periodontopathic bacteria in the samples of dogs, a quantitative real-time polymerase chain reaction (PCR) was performed for quantification of 11 human periodontopathic bacteria as follows: Aggregatibacter actinomycetemcomitans (Aa), Porphyromonas gingivalis (Pg), Tannerella forsythia, Treponema denticola (Td), Fusobacterium nucleatum, Prevotella nigrescens, Prevotella intermedia, Parvimonas micra, Eubacterium nodatum, Campylobacter rectus, and Eikenella corrodens. The PCR results showed that Aa and Pg, the representative periodontopathic bacteria, were not significantly correlated or associated with the periodontitis cases in dogs. However, interestingly, Td was strongly associated with the irreversible periodontal disease in dogs, in that it was the most prevalent bacterium detected from the dog samples. These findings indicate that the presence and numbers of Td could be used as a prognostic biomarker in predicting the irreversible periodontal disease and the disease severity in dogs.

The topographic anatomy of the ventral margin of the paracaval portion of the caudate lobe of the human liver has not been clearly described to date. To this end we hypothesize the existence of a precaudate plane, a flat or slightly curved plane defined by the ventral margins of the ligamentum venosum and the hilar plate. Using 76 cadaveric livers, we investigated whether the paracaval portion of the caudate lobe extended ventral to this plane and whether the paracaval caudate branch of the portal vein (PC) ran through this plane to its ventral side. In 28 of the specimens (36.8%), the PC extended over the plane to a variable depth: less than 10 mm in 10 specimens, 10-20 mm in 10, and more than 20 mm in eight specimens. This ventral extension of the PC consistently included its penetration into the dome-like area under the terminals of the three major hepatic veins; therefore, the ventrally extended PC often interdigitated with these veins and their tributaries (in practice, the ventral margin of the paracaval portion of the caudate lobe could generally be considered to run alongside the middle hepatic vein). Moreover, the ventral extension of the PC often reached the upper, diaphragmatic surface or the dorsal surface of the liver immediately to the right of the inferior vena cava. Several branches (termed border branches) in the ventral extension were difficult to identify as belonging to the PC. We discuss both the marginal configuration of the paracaval portion of the caudate lobe and how to identify and operate on the ventrally extended PC and related border branches during liver surgery.
